Dustin Poirier, a top UFC lightweight and founder of The Good Fight Foundation, opens up about his journey since winning at UFC 299. He shares insights on navigating the mental challenges post-fight losses and the importance of resilience. The conversation takes a humorous turn with discussions on peculiar organ donations and bonding over Louisiana crawfish season. Poirier also spills his predictions for UFC 300 while reflecting on the emotional aspects of being a fighter and the evolving landscape of combat sports.

ANECDOTE

Post-Gaethje Low Point

  • Dustin Poirier experienced one of his lowest points mentally after his loss to Justin Gaethje.
  • He felt down and out of sync with life, like the world was throwing him away after all his hard work.
INSIGHT

Finding Perspective

  • Dustin Poirier realized the importance of perspective after his loss.
  • Fighting is his career, but his identity encompasses being a father, husband, and more.
ANECDOTE

Green Room Funeral

  • After Poirier's loss, the atmosphere in his green room felt like a funeral.
  • He tried to lighten the mood, assuring everyone he was still present.
